S 501 New Jersey Senate · 2026-2027 Regular Session

Permits member of New Jersey National Guard to transfer certain tuition benefit to spouse or dependent child.

This bill (S 501) allows New Jersey National Guard members who qualify for tuition-free education to transfer that benefit to their spouse or dependent child. It directly affects Guard members who complete required training and are in good standing, and their immediate family members pursuing undergraduate or graduate studies. The key provision requires the spouse or child to be enrolled full-time at a New Jersey public college or university, have applied for all available state and federal financial aid, and receive the benefit for one person only. The transfer does not change the existing requirements for the Guard member to qualify for the original tuition benefit.
